Day 4
Today I woke up to monkeys on my balcony making noise and jumping around. Shortly after noticing the monkey sitting staring at me on my window sill, my doorbell rang. Still not fully awake, I had to show two new students around and find a room for them since Swami (our yoga instructor) was gone for the weekend. No big deal…glad to help I took a bucket shower this morning. Because there is no shower, they fill a bucket with hot and cold water adjusted to your temp, and use a cup to pour the water over yourself. I was so cold that I ended up standing in the bucket to absorb as much warmth as possible…I even tried to sit in it…didn’t work… I am thinking about buying a wash bin, the kind you wash clothes in and making a bath out of it…I can tell that this bucket thing will be getting old soon I consider myself one of the lucky ones who has a toilet vs a hole in the ground like some of the other rooms. Anyways one of the fellow students, Michelle and I, went on a hike in the Himalayas to a waterfall. There were actually two of them and a cavern area. Cant wait to show everyone the pics! It was absolutely beautiful! We got back and headed straight to the yoga studio and did sun salutations and head stands. Michelle has been teaching for 8 yrs, so she is already advanced…unlike my 2 bikram sessions of yoga. That is the extent of my yoga experience Because I am physically fit, she showed me how to do advanced posses which I seemed to pick right up. I am really liking yoga!
